WHAT HAPPENED

Russia said on Monday that seven people, including three children, had been killed and 40 injured at its Black Sea holiday resort of Gelendzhik in what it said was a deliberate Ukrainian drone attack on civilians. There was no immediate comment from Ukraine, which like Russia, ‌says it does not deliberately target civilians in the full-scale war which Moscow launched in 2022.
